Star Wars: The Force Unleashed

Story

The next chapter in the Star Wars saga, Star Wars: The Force Unleashed
, tells the story of Darth Vader's Secret Apprentice, a mysterious
figure trained by the menacing Sith Lord, to hunt down the last of the
Jedi.
Set in the dark times between Episodes III and IV, the story is both a
continuation of the prequel trilogy – exploring the aftermath of Order
66, which called for the immediate execution of all Jedi, and focusing
on the continued rise of Darth Vader – and a direct bridge to the
Original Trilogy. The Force Unleashed  will forever change the fate of
the Galaxy and explain key plot points that directly lead into events
in Star Wars: A New Hope.
The Secret Apprentice's journey takes him across the Galaxy—from the
Wookiee homeworld of Kashyyyk to the junkyard planet Raxus Prime and
the mushroom-covered planet, Felucia.
He is aided in his dangerous missions by a loyal sidekick PROXY - a
prototype holodroid with amazing abilities, and an alluring Imperial
pilot named Juno Eclipse.
The Apprentice will clash with powerful enemies, including the
spirited Zabrak warrior Maris Brood, Jedi Master Shaak Ti, and General
Rahm Kota, a hard-boiled Jedi soldier who senses that the Apprentice
is destined to become something far greater than just Darth Vader's
servant.
